Transaction 02130706b43a7fbf9de788892704fbc54e912650bf1ab8d2ca1b8d954f5e4cdf

block
04477463b90c8fb9694d75025d2a829519ed93b39823995071fe2c71aabcd674

4 Inputs

15 Outputs